Course analysis (2015/16 period 1) DD2380 Artificial Intelligence, 6hp Course responsible: Patric Jensfelt Lecturers: Patric Jensfelt and Johannes Stork Course assistants: Johannes Stork, Akshaya Thippur, Kaiyu Hang, Joshua Haustein, Judith Bütepage, Didrik Lundberg, Fabian Schilling, Benjamin Coors Number of lectures: 13 lectures (26 hours) Registered students: 282 according to VIS "Prestationsgrad"

• overall: 85% (80% last year) • women: 77% (69% last year)

"Examinationgrad" • overall: 80% (77% last year) • women: 76% (63% last year)

Course material:

• Book: Artificial Intelligence: A Modern Approach (by Stuart J. Russell and Peter Norvig, Prentice Hall

• Lecture notes: Available for download from course webpage Examination requirements:

• LAB1 3hp � 2 homework assignments � 1 essay on ethics � Quizzes on most lecture topics

• PRO1 3hp � Project completed in groups of 4 students � Identify and address an NLP problem � Write a report � Present the work orally

Summary of impressions: The course was well received and that students found it interesting. The average grade on a 1-10 scale was 7,74 regarding how interesting it was. We switched to a scale 1-10 this year so it is not directly comparable but 90% gave it 6 or over on the 10 grade scale so this has to be considered very positive. There were too many deadlines! Relation to the previous years: The biggest differences from last year were:

• Criteria based grading o The by far biggest difference from previous years is that we based the

grading on criteria, one per ILO. This resulted in a more complex but

at the same time a more transparent system, where it was more clear what a certain grade actually corresponded to.

• Less emphasis on report writing in the project o This worked quite well, with less time on the writing which is

practiced in many other courses • Provided students with an HMM implementation that could be used for HW2.

o This unfortunately had the opposite effect of what was intended for most students. Instead of getting a better understanding of HMM by being able to experiment with a working implementation from the start and not spending time implementing it, many used it as a blackbox and tested different functions until one seemed to solve the problem. This resulted in less understanding.

• Quizzes on more topics o We provided a quiz for almost all topics taught in the course to ensure

that we examine all aspects of it. Topics covered in guest lectures were not examined.

• Oral examination of HW1 and HW2 o Previous years we have been relying on kattis to assess solutions and

grading was based purely on performance. This year, every student had to present HW1 and HW2 to show that they had an understanding that matched the performance.

• Ethics component o We had a lecture on ethics and students wrote an essay on ethics

regarding the impact of AI on the future job market and some other aspect of choice. Mostly nice essays, but the high volume meant that the feedback was of low quality as it was provided by the course responsible alone.

Grading: A criteria based grading scheme was used. The Quizzes and the Essay were only graded Pass/Fail. The final grade was based on the grade on HW1, HW2 and the project. Assessment tasks had criteria for grades E, C and A and levels in between were awarded in cases where not all but some requirements where fulfilled at one level. As the project was carried out in groups and the influence of a single person on the grade is less the grade was given as an interval E-C or C-A. The final grade was the minimum of that from HW1 and HW2 and the one from the project were E-C counted as C and C-A counted as A. The interval grading for the project was intended to relieve some pressure. However, the result was also that many discussions on the project came to be about “what the minimum requirement was for being inside the C-A bracket. Homework assignments: Like before the homework assignments focused on implementation and were corrected automatically by the course portal system. As mentioned before, this year we followed this up with an oral examination.

Planned changes:

• Reduce number of deadlines. Instead of one deadline per quiz use only one deadline at the end and treat this as a replacement for the written exam.

• Make project optional and only for higher grades. • Require students to implement HMM from scratch again • Restructure the homework assignment so that it more clear what the

different grades correspond to with ore guidance for the lower grades. • Vary the length of presentation slots depending on the grade aimed for.

Check that the requirement at E level are met is usually faster than those at A level.

• Use peer-review for the ethics essay t generate better and faster feedback
